Adhesive for Ceramic Tiles onto Ditra Matting
Anonymous user 15/03/2024 - 2.35 PM
Hi-I will be installing Ditra matting the a plywood subfloor using ultrabond Eco VS90 but need to know what adhesive to use when laying the ceramic tiles onto the ditra once it has been put in place? I currently have Ardex X7G (Standard setting flexible adhesive) for the job. Is this adhesive good to use for this? or is a non-flexible adhesive better

Hi, I would adise popping into topps tiles, as they have the BAL products, these are in my experience the best tile adhesive that can be used, I have never had a problem with them, even when tiling a ceiling in a wet shower room. i refuse to use any other brands because we always give gaurantees to our work.
now plywood is a very vulnerable material in bathrooms, as if water does penetrate through to it, then it will cause alot of problems. we normally use hardie backer cement boards that come in 8 to 12mm of thickness, these laid on top of a floor surface and sealed properly will make sure you have no problems, however the Ditra Matting is now a widely used new method.
In my opinion, not that you have to take my word for it, however good to acknowledge and do your homework, I recommend you should use BAL max-flex fibre adhesive, BAL rapid flex fibre plus adhesive, or BAL single part flexible adhesive.
these are all very durable, sustainable against water, and allow for flexibility and any other movement or temperature changes.
